### v4.3.0 — Rotation

Heads up, reviewer: this bumps the gateway signing key for Furrowlink, our farm-equipment telemetry gateway. The old key was shared with the retired staging fleet, which made auditors twitchy, so we minted a fresh one scoped to production tractors only. Firmware manifests signed before this release stay valid for 30 days. Everything downstream reads the key from config, so the only real change is here:

rollout seal: bky3_xks

## Authentication

Following the Marrowvale stale-cache incident, the postmortem tooling now requires authenticated access to replay cached responses safely. Support staff investigating similar reports should use the read-only replay credential rather than personal accounts, so every lookup is audited. The credential rotates monthly and is scoped to the replay endpoint only. Current key below.

API key for yahig-tadup: kto7_ubizbYm

## Changed defaults — Hermetic build migration (Brickforge)

We moved the Lanternfish build onto Brickforge's hermetic toolchain, so a bunch of defaults shifted. Network access during builds is now off, sandbox paths are pinned, and toolchain versions are locked per-target. If something breaks, check the sandbox first, not your shell. The defaults the service now ships with are listed below.

deployment values, hahip-kajep:
HOLAX_PIN=4003
HOLAX_METRICS_HOST=metrics.holax.zemvarworks.internal
HOLAX_LOG_LEVEL=warn
HOLAX_TENANT=fraael

Handover: cron drift investigation (Tidewheel scheduler)

For plugin authors picking this up: we confirmed the drift comes from plugins registering jobs with local timezones instead of UTC; the Tidewheel host reconciles hourly, so offsets compound. Please audit your manifests and pin schedules to UTC. I've left my trace notes in the shared scratch repo. To unlock the archived trace bundle, use the recovery passphrase below.

unlock words, kawig-bawef: belax-sorir-druax-ulaiel-wenael-belael